Baguette Diamond
The single gemstone in this ring is a 0.20 carat baguette diamond. It’s flush set lengthwise along one edge of the band, adding a nice sparkle without taking over the design. Its off-center position brings some contemporary overtones to the ring, and this integrates nicely with the setting choice as well.
While gemstones are not always included in men’s wedding rings, adding a small accent like this is a great way to mark the significance of such a special piece. It can also allow you to build a connection between the men’s and women’s rings that make up the wedding set, representing the link you share even when you’re apart.
Contrasting Finishes
The top of this ring is brushed to create a matte finish, but the fronts are polished to a high shine. This contrast adds a layer of complexity to an otherwise minimalist design that makes it a much more interesting piece and much more eye-catching. The use of a brushed finish on top also helps the diamond stand out by presenting a more subdued background for the stone’s stunning sparkle.
Adding a Personal Touch
One hidden feature our client requested for this piece was to have an inscription in hebrew engraved on the inside of the band. This is an excellent way to add a personal touch to your piece while still keeping the outside low-key, and it can be extra special to have a feature like this that no one knows about except you and your partner. Customizing This Design
Any Joseph Jewelry item can be customized or used as the starting point for a new custom design. The gemstones, metal, proportions, setting style, surface details, and overall profile can be adjusted to better match your preferences, style, and budget.
Every custom piece begins with a conversation about what you want to create and what matters most to you. You work one-on-one with a designer to refine the concept, review the design direction, and create a detailed 3D CAD image of the item before it is made.
After the design is approved, we can create a wax model so you can review the piece physically. This step helps you evaluate scale, proportions, shape, and overall presence before final production begins.
Once the wax model is approved, our jewelers craft the finished piece with attention to structure, finish, stone security, and long-term wear. Each adjustment is reviewed carefully so the final item feels intentional, balanced, and made specifically for you.
